public class RuleEngineClient extends AbstractBceClient
config, DEFAULT_CONTENT_TYPE, DEFAULT_ENCODING, DEFAULT_SERVICE_DOMAIN, URL_PREFIX| Constructor and Description |
|---|
RuleEngineClient(BceClientConfiguration config) |
RuleEngineClient(String accessKey,
String secretKey) |
| Modifier and Type | Method and Description |
|---|---|
Rule |
createDestination(Destination request) |
Rule |
createRule(CreateRuleRequest request) |
void |
deleteDestination(String uuid) |
void |
deleteRule(DeleteRulesRequest request) |
void |
disableRule(String ruleId) |
void |
enableRule(String ruleId) |
Rule |
getRule(String uuid) |
ListRuleResponse |
listRules(ListRuleRequest request)
list all the rules under this account
|
Rule |
updateRule(UpdateRuleRequest request) |
computeServiceId, getClient, getEndpoint, getServiceId, invokeHttpClient, isRegionSupported, setClient, shutdownpublic RuleEngineClient(BceClientConfiguration config)
public ListRuleResponse listRules(ListRuleRequest request)
request: - specify the pageNo, pageSize etc.public Rule createRule(CreateRuleRequest request)
public Rule updateRule(UpdateRuleRequest request)
public void deleteRule(DeleteRulesRequest request)
public void disableRule(String ruleId)
public void enableRule(String ruleId)
public Rule createDestination(Destination request)
public void deleteDestination(String uuid)
Copyright © 2022. All rights reserved.